Robin Perez is a Board Certified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ner. Robin has worked as an outpatient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ner since 2001. He began his work as a PMHNP at Luke-Dorf, Inc from 2001 to 2002 and then at Western Psychological & Clinical Services, PC from 2002 to 2006. In 2002 he started his current private psychiatric mental health rural practice, which services people living in the Portland metro and surrounding areas.

During Robin's career as a registered nurse (RN) he worked at Utah Valley Regional Medical Center on their inpatient psychiatric units for adults and children. He also worked at the University of Utah Hospital as an ICU nurse. When Robin moved to Oregon to attend OHSU, he worked as a floating RN on several medical units including oncology, bone marrow transplant, burn ICU, neurological ICU, and cardiac ICU at many of the hospitals in the Portland area.

Most who see Robin seek help for various problems including depression, anxiety (and associated disorders like OCD, PTSD, etc.) bipolar, ADHD, sleep disorders, relationship issues, or other problems.
